Margot's grandmere tells her that "... just listen… and the answers will pour into your soul." Do you believe your loved ones can still be present in your life, even after they've died?

Margot's grandmere tells her that she won't always be around. "But when the world is black, when you think you are alone, the spirits, my spirit, will be with you… When you don't know the answers, just listen… and the answers will pour into your soul." Did you find that this played out at any point in the novel? Do you believe your loved ones can still be present in your life, even after they've died?

I do and I don't think this belief is related to any particular religion or spiritual belief. As humans we internalize the values, morals, and thoughts of our loved ones. Even when they are not present due to physical distance or even death we can "hear" what they would say to us if they could. Although both of my parents have been dead for decades, I can sense their thoughts and feelings on various issues that are confronting me. As human, we are truly never alone.
